WebApr 11, 2024 · Long-term pimobendan therapy has been assessed in Congestive Heart Failure (PICO) trial with 317 ambulatory patients with NYHA class II to III congestive HF. Patients received 1.25 or 2.5mg twice daily for 6 months. Results indicated an increase in exercise duration. Congestive heart failure is a weakening of the heart caused by an underlying heart or blood vessel problem, or a … WebMar 5, 2024 · Potassium-sparing diuretics, such as amiloride (Midamor®) and spironolactone (Aldactone®), are used to treat high blood pressure and congestive heart failure. These medications decrease the amount of potassium lost in the urine and can make potassium levels too high, especially in people who have kidney problems. Loop …
